Our first visit to Westerley. The quality and presentation of the food was of a high standard, as was the customer service. Good choice of menu, including fish, meat and vegetarian options. The restaurant itself has a nice atmosphere and has views over the river and town. Prices are great value compared to commercial restaurants. Allow plenty of time for a meal because the students are learning as they prepare the food and serve you - it's worth it for the quality of food and for the opportunity to help young people prepare for their careers.
